AboutVilmist 200 DPI Capsule is an inhaled combination medicine used for the long-term management of as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) to improve breathing and reduce flare-ups.Usage Instructions: Use only with the provided dry powder inhaler device. Do not swallow the capsule. Load one capsule, inhale deeply and steadily, hold breath for a few seconds, then exhale. Rinse mouth after use.Benefits: Helps control asthma and COPD symptoms; Reduces wheezing, chest tightness, and shortness of breath; Supports better lung function with regular use.How it Works: Vilanterol relaxes airway muscles (long-acting bronchodilator), while fluticasone furoate reduces airway inflammation (inhaled corticosteroid).Side Effects: Throat irritation, hoarseness, headache, cough, oral thrush, tremor, or palpitations may occur.Safety Advice: Not for sudden asthma attacks. Rinse mouth after each use to reduce thrush risk. Inform the doctor about heart disease, diabetes, thyroid issues, tuberculosis, or glaucoma. Regular monitoring is advised.Storage: Store below 25°C in a dry place. Keep capsules in blister until use. Protect from moisture and light.
